LONDON — A document accidentally
leaked online specifying which flags will be permitted at the Eurovision venue this year has triggered anger across Europe.
The guidelines, which are meant to keep politics out of the song contest,*
say that only flags from United Nations members can be flown. The
guidelines specifically banned the Islamic State (ISIS) flag, but also included examples of other flags **t allowed, like those of Palestine, Kosovo and Crimea.
